Shaler Area School District Seeks Public Comment on Proposed Ed-Flex Waiver
Shaler Area School District is seeking public comment on a proposed Ed-Flex waiver related to the use of Title IV, Part A funds. Stakeholders are invited to review the waiver request and provide feedback to help inform the decision-making process.
The proposed waiver would provide the district with greater flexibility to use Title IV, Part A funds to address identified instructional priorities rather than meeting the minimum spending requirements under Sections 4106 and 4109.
The district is proposing to use these funds to implement IXL Learning and Raz-Kids for students in grades K–3 at Marzolf and Reserve Primary Schools. These evidence-based instructional resources will provide personalized, standards-aligned learning opportunities that supplement classroom instruction and strengthen foundational literacy and mathematics skills.
IXL Learning will provide individualized mathematics practice, immediate feedback, targeted skill recommendations, and progress monitoring to help teachers identify learning gaps and differentiate instruction. Raz-Kids will provide students with access to leveled texts designed to support reading fluency, comprehension, and independent reading both at school and at home. The programs’ assessment and reporting tools will allow teachers to monitor student progress and provide targeted support based on individual student needs.
The district anticipates that the waiver will help increase student engagement and achievement, strengthen individualized instruction, improve foundational reading and mathematics skills, and provide targeted interventions for students in the early elementary grades.
